Tbe month’s attendance in the diflerent rooms lor January waa as follows 1st and 2nd grades, 89 per cent.; 3rd and 4th grades, 73 per cent.; 4th and les — per cent.; 7th end 8th grades, 88 per cent. Tliere ere still several popila quarantined, and ibis partly accounts for the poor attendance. SUNDAY'S BREAKFAST The way 1 prepare a Sunday’s break, fast for four people is as followsI provide two grape fruits, a half-dosen coffee cakes, one bsg of buckwheat, cue pound sausage, coffee, etc. Before breakfast I spread the tablecloth and set the napkins, dishes, silverware, and pert of the lood in their proper places. Wb'le doing tliis the water w* foiling lor the coffee. I put the sausage cook, made the buckwheat ca k es and the coffee ; then everything was ready. After breakfast, I cleared the table, pot away the remaining food, washed the dishes, and my work was done. Amavda Dallas.
